#ef4209 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ef4209 is composed of 93.7% red, 25.9%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 14.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 48.6%. #ef4209 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8412 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#ef4209 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ef4209 has RGB values of R:239, G:66,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.96,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15680009.

Shades and Tints of #ef4209
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0300 is the darkest color, while #fffa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ef4209
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7c7b is the less saturated color, while #ef4209 is the most saturated one.
